Fayette, Georgia Population By Ethnicity in Census 2020

Updated on February 22, 2026.

According to the data from the US 2020 decennial Census, in April 2020, among Fayette, GA population of 119,194 people, 57.17% (68,144) identified their ethnicity as Non-Hispanic - White Alone, 24.47% (29,166) identified their ethnicity as Non-Hispanic - Black or African American Alone, and 5.34% (6,362) identified their ethnicity as Non-Hispanic - Asian Alone.

Ethnicity Population % of County Population
Non-Hispanic - White Alone 68144 57.17
Non-Hispanic - Black or African American Alone 29166 24.47
Non-Hispanic - Asian Alone 6362 5.34
Non-Hispanic - Two Or More Races 4938 4.14
Hispanic - Two Or More Races 4087 3.43
Hispanic - Some Other Race Alone 3087 2.59
Hispanic - White Alone 1644 1.38
Non-Hispanic - Some Other Race Alone 848 0.71
Hispanic - Black or African American Alone 393 0.33
Non-Hispanic - American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 212 0.18
Hispanic - American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 198 0.17
Hispanic - Asian Alone 57 0.05
Non-Hispanic -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 44 0.04
Hispanic -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 14 0.01
